Stillen HFC and Berk CBE discontinued. Thoughts on why?
 
Just curious if you guys have thoughts on these things getting discontinued? The Berk CBE seemed fairly popular. Are makers getting out of the 370z market?

It's supply and demand. It's not as popular as the Motordyne or Fast Intentions, so they probably can't justify the cost they would charge someone and the amount of work that goes into manufacturing the exhaust. If the popularity was there, they'd be able to buy the piping in bulk at cheaper rates. As for Stillen, there are cheaper options out there so it's hard on them to offer a product that doesn't have the demand it once did, same scenario.
